How to fill out the Copart Power Of Attorney online
The Copart Power Of Attorney is a crucial document that enables an individual to authorize Copart, Inc. to act on their behalf regarding vehicle ownership transfers.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ions for filling out the form online.
Follow the steps to complete the Copart Power Of Attorney form efficiently.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it in the document editor.
- Begin filling out the form by entering the state where the document will be executed in the designated area labeled 'STATE of ____________'. This is important for legal validity.
- Next, in the first blank field, enter the full name of the owner who is granting this Power of Attorney. This should be the person who is allowing Copart to act on their behalf.
- In the next section, input the name of the buyer or entity that will be represented by Copart. This identifies who will benefit from the actions taken under this Power of Attorney.
- Review the section that outlines the powers granted to Copart, confirming that it includes the ability to fill out, complete, and sign vehicle titles and necessary documents for ownership transfer.
- Indicate the effective date of the Power of Attorney by filling in the date format '___/____/____'. This date marks when the powers commence and remain effective until revoked.
- Complete the date of execution at the bottom of the form by indicating the day and month alongside the year.
- Finally, sign the form with the name of the company or the owner, as appropriate, and ensure that it is completed in accordance with any specific laws that may apply in your state.
- Once all fields are filled, review the entire document for accuracy then save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.
